    4. DAILY CHECK WARNING 1. Before check and maintenance of the compressor, carefully read “TO USE IN SAFETY” ( see p.2) again. 2. Be sure to disconect the power when check or maintenance is carried out. Then, make sure the fan inverter’s charge lamp and the DCBL controller’s charge lamp, goes off after about 10 minutes elapse.

    7. INSTRUCTIONS FOR INSTALLATION [Compressor Room Ventilation] 7.5 Compressor Room Ventilation Ventilation data (1) Large amounts of heat are discharged from the Model compressor as exhaust. Be sure to provide suffi- OSP-55VAN OSP-75VAN Item cient ventilation. Amounts of heat generated from Heat generation MJ/h the compressor are given in the table on the right.

    8. PERIODIC MAINTENANCE CAUTION ● Before Maintenance work, read “To Use in Safety” ( see p. 2) again carefully. ● Be sure to disconnect the power, wait for about 10 minutes, and make sure that charge lamp of DCBL controller and fan inverter are off when check or maintenance is carried out. If not, such work may cause serious accident like electric shock.
